Internal Locus
The belief that one's own actions and behaviors are the primary determinants of the outcomes in their life.
Positive Involvement
A concept referring to active and constructive participation in activities or initiatives, which promotes overall well-being and success.
Type A Behavior
A pattern characterized by high levels of competitiveness, self-driven ambition, impatience, and a sense of urgency, often linked to stress and health issues.
Heart Disease
A range of conditions that affect the heart, including blood vessel diseases, heart rhythm problems (arrhythmias), and heart defects you're born with (congenital heart defects), among others.
